Stress & Anxiety Could Be A Wellknown Problem For A Ton Of Women & Men

We all experience some level of anxiety every now and then. It's normal to experience anxiety in such situations. When there are not any immediate threats present then there are people who experience stress on a frequent basis, and feel apprehensive. Treatment is required by this type of anxiety.
Before we get into a number of the treatment options, it's necessary to understand what anxiety is, and the way it occurs.
When the body responds to an imaginary threat as if it were real stress occurs. Our heart rate and breathing changes, adrenaline starts flowing, and we sweat as we go into the fight or flight response. There are times when this comes in handy, but the individual who has an anxiety disorder goes well beyond that stage.
Though you may manage to live with all the occasional bout of stress, you must seek treatment if it's causing a negative impact on your own life. A negative impact is whatever takes away from your personal quality of life, as well as your enjoyment of it. One of the problems of diagnosing anxiety is that lots of the symptoms may be related to other conditions. Ergo, the sufferer may assume they have another medical problem, when in reality they actually have an anxiety disorder. Symptoms can include, but are not restricted to: shortness of breath, chest pain, nausea, strong heartbeat, fatigue, headaches, stomach pains, and sleeplessness. That's very a list, is not it? Someone having a strong pulse and pain in their own chest would be completely justified in believing they were having a heart attack, but it might only be a panic attack.
NOTE: Even though you've got anxiety, the symptoms of a heart attack should never be disregarded.
A man who has an anxiety disorder thinks differently. For the sake of example, let's say snakes make them concerned. Our sufferer sees a picture of a snake, and then his body and mind go into an alternative state. He sees the picture and thinks about how some snakes are poisonous, and they're able to bite. "What if," he thinks to himself, "a snake bites me?" He continues by imagining being bitten, injected with venom, perishing, and leaving his family destitute due to his being dead. All of this from seeing a picture!
However, his issue is how to stop the effect of these thoughts once they happen. Lots of the treatments for anxiety are intended to terminate the thought process, and a perception of calm replaces the sense of anxiety.
